He was born April 8, 1927 in Urbana, IL to the late Guy and Margaret (Yates) Taylor.
On May 28, 1950 he was united in marriage to Betty J. (Money) Taylor and she survives.
Guy worked in the air conditioning industry for many years before working at the Lowe’s in Mooresville. He enjoyed model railroading in his spare time.
Along with his parents, Guy was also preceded in death by his son, David A. Taylor.
Survivors include his wife of 66 years, Betty; two sons, Mark D. Taylor of Mooresville and Brian K. (Susan) Taylor of Shelbyville; daughter, Lori E. (Paul Troup) Messer of Columbus, Ohio; five grandchildren, Kelli (Ricky) Navare, Kimberli (Brent) Linneman, Adam (Sara) Taylor, Kailene (Rusty) Pitts, Kevin Messer; and five great grandchildren.
Family and friends will gather for visitation from 10:00 a.m. until 11:00 a.m. on Tuesday, July 12, 2016 in the chapel at Carlisle-Branson Funeral Service & Crematory, Mooresville.
A graveside service will be conducted at 11:30 a.m. on Tuesday at Mooresville Cemetery.
